    Description :

    Non negative pressure variable frequency water supply equipmentFeatures: The non negative pressure steady flow tank has automatic control accessories such as liquid level detection, pressure detection, vacuum cleaner, etc. This device has significant energy-saving effects, does not require the construction of a water tank, does not require regular cleaning and disinfection, and has low investment costs.

      1. Integrated design, compact structure, direct installation of the system in the water tank (reducing the construction of pump rooms if outdoors), low investment, easy installation, and beautiful appearance.

      2. By utilizing the superposition of pipeline pressure and automatic frequency conversion operation mode, the energy-saving effect has been significantly improved (40% for large pipelines).

      3. Easy to install, with only one municipal pipeline inlet and one water supply outlet.

      4. Stable operation, low vibration, and low noise (noise level below 50 decibels).

      5. The system's water supply is stable (even if the pipeline network is temporarily cut off, it can still be supplied normally through the water tank), fully ensuring the pressure at the end of the system.

      6. Automatic inspection function can be added to reduce property management costs.

      7. Adopting PLC programmable control for fully automatic operation, easy operation and maintenance.

      The water from the tap water pipeline enters the steady flow compensation tank, and the air inside the tank is discharged from the vacuum suppressor. After the water is filled, the vacuum suppressor automatically shuts off. When the pressure of the tap water network can meet the water requirements, the system will supply water directly from the bypass to the system network; When the pressure of the tap water network cannot meet the water demand, the system pressure signal is fed back to the variable frequency controller through a remote pressure gauge. The water pump runs and automatically adjusts the speed and constant pressure water supply according to the amount of water used. If the running water pump reaches the power frequency speed, another water pump will start variable frequency operation. When the water pump is supplying water, if the water volume in the tap water network is greater than the flow rate of the water pump, the system will maintain normal water supply; During peak water usage, if the water volume in the tap water network is less than the flow rate of the water pump, the water in the steady flow compensator can still be supplied normally as a supplementary water source. At this time, air enters the steady flow compensator through a vacuum suppressor, damaging the vacuum environment inside the compensator and avoiding the impact of insufficient water supply on the municipal pipeline network. After the peak water usage, the system returns to normal water supply. When the water supply network is shut down, causing the liquid level of the steady flow compensator to continuously decrease, the liquid level controller will feedback the signal to the variable frequency controller, and the water pump will automatically stop to protect the water pump unit.
